Red Hill

The neighbourhood of Red Hill is part of the city of Hamilton, Ontario, which is situated in the Greater Hamilton metropolitan area.

Transportation

This area is an extraordinarily good part of Hamilton for driving. Coming across a place to park is easy, and the majority of houses for sale are a very short drive from the closest highway, such as Red Hill Valley Parkway. On the other hand, the public transit service in this area is not very frequent. Nonetheless, homeowners are served by a few bus lines, and bus stops are not very far from most homes. Getting around by bicycle is easy in Red Hill. However, walking is not very popular in Red Hill, although many common errands can be run on foot.

Services

Parents and their schoolchildren will welcome that wherever their property is located in this area, daycares and primary schools are close by. On the other hand, this part of Hamilton does not have any high schools. With regards to eating, a car is usually needed in Red Hill to reach the nearest supermarket. Nonetheless, pharmacies are typically very easy to get to on foot and supply some staple foods. A limited variety of restaurants is available in Red Hill as well.

Character

The character of Red Hill is exemplified by its relaxed atmosphere. Parks, like Greenhill Open Space, are very well-situated and there are a few of them close by for residents to explore, resulting in them being very easy to reach from most locations within this area. This part of Hamilton is also very quiet, as there are low levels of noise from traffic close to Red Hill Valley Parkway or the railway line.

Housing

Around one third of dwellings are large apartment buildings, making it easy to find apartments in Red Hill, while the rest are mainly single detached homes. The majority of the properties in this neighbourhood were built between 1960 and 1980, while many of the remaining buildings were constructed in the 1980s and the 1990s. This part of Hamilton offers mainly two bedroom and three bedroom homes. Around 60% of the population of this neighbourhood own their home while the remainder are renters.
